Usa requestAnimationFrame no navegador. Sem instalação.
Esta página mede FPS renderizado no navegador e estima a cadência da tela. Ela não lê o hardware do monitor diretamente.
Verificador de FPS do navegador
Teste de FPS
Coletando dados
Meça FPS renderizado no navegador, compare o movimento com presets de referência e veja se a sessão parece suave, limitada ou inconsistente.
—FPS
FPS atual—FPS médio—Mín / Máx—Tempo de frame—Taxa estimadaPrecisa de mais dados
Teclado: Tab percorre todos os controles em ordem, e Enter ou Espaço ativa o botão selecionado.
AgoraJanela de 10s
Ainda sem amostras. Inicie o teste para preencher o gráfico rolante de dez segundos.
Teste de frame rate pronto.
Resumo acessível
Resumo em texto da janela mais recente
Use este resumo em linguagem simples se o gráfico estiver difícil de ler ou se você estiver navegando com tecnologia assistiva.
FPS atual
—
FPS médio
—
FPS mínimo
—
FPS máximo
—
Tempo médio de quadro
—
Rótulo de estabilidade
Coletando dados
Taxa de atualização estimada
Precisa de mais dados
O gráfico vai da esquerda para a direita pelos últimos dez segundos. Uma linha mais plana indica ritmo mais estável, enquanto quedas bruscas ou oscilações amplas apontam para drops visíveis ou frame pacing inconsistente.
Interpretação
Resumo contínuo de dez segundos
Inicie o teste para medir o FPS renderizado, estimar a cadência observada e comparar tudo com os presets de referência.
Presets de referência
Alterne entre presets UFO de 30, 60, 120, 144 e 240 FPS para comparar faixas de movimento no mesmo viewport.
🛸🛸🛸🛸
Preset atual: 60 FPS.
A animação de referência serve apenas para comparação visual e ainda pode ser limitada pelo navegador, dispositivo e tela.
FPS vs taxa de atualização
O FPS do navegador mostra quantos frames esta página realmente renderiza. A taxa estimada é só uma aproximação com base no timing recente, não uma leitura direta do hardware.
A taxa de atualização estimada vem apenas do timing recente do navegador. Leituras ambíguas continuam marcadas como baixa confiança.
O que este frame rate test mede
Este frame rate test mede com que frequência o navegador está renderizando frames visíveis agora. A página usa requestAnimationFrame, então funciona como um browser FPS test prático, não como leitura direta da especificação do monitor. Essa diferença importa. O navegador pode mostrar FPS menor ou menos estável do que a tela suporta por causa de modo de economia de energia, carga em segundo plano, limitação da aba ou do próprio browser. O número ao vivo, o frame time e o gráfico rolante mostram tanto o valor atual quanto o padrão recente. Por isso a página serve como FPS checker, frame rate checker, dropped frames test e browser rendering test em uma mesma rota.
Frame rate vs refresh rate: qual é a diferença?
Frame rate é quantos frames o navegador realmente produz por segundo. Refresh rate é quantas vezes a tela consegue atualizar a imagem por segundo. Por isso um monitor de 144 Hz ainda pode mostrar FPS menor se o navegador, o sistema ou o caminho gráfico estiverem limitados. Este frame rate test estima a cadência observada no browser, mas deixa claro quando a confiança é baixa. Para buscas como refresh rate vs fps, fps vs hz e monitor fps test, a pergunta real costuma ser simples: a suavidade vem da tela, do navegador ou dos dois alinhados?
Como ler seu gráfico de FPS
O gráfico mostra os últimos dez segundos de FPS medido no navegador. Uma linha mais reta costuma indicar frame pacing mais estável. Pequenas oscilações são normais. O mais importante é o padrão. Se a linha fica perto de 60, 120 ou 144 FPS, você provavelmente está vendo um cap estável. Se há quedas bruscas seguidas de recuperação, isso aponta para dropped frames ou travadas curtas. Se a linha balança demais, a sessão está inconsistente o bastante para a suavidade parecer irregular mesmo com picos altos.
Por que seu FPS pode parecer limitado
Um resultado capped não significa defeito automaticamente. Muitos navegadores, sistemas e dispositivos seguram animações em patamares comuns como 60 FPS, 90 FPS, 120 FPS ou 144 FPS. Economia de energia, telas espelhadas, docks, adaptadores, limites térmicos e políticas do browser podem reduzir o número observado. Quem chega esperando um high refresh rate test e vê algo menor muitas vezes está vendo a realidade do navegador naquele ambiente, não o marketing do monitor.
Os presets de referência existem para tornar o frame pacing visível. Em 30 FPS, o movimento costuma parecer bem mais quebrado. Em 60 FPS, muita gente já considera aceitável, mas ainda menos fluido do que em taxas maiores. Em 120 FPS e 144 FPS, a diferença costuma ser clara em telas compatíveis. Em 240 FPS, o ganho depende mais do navegador, do painel e da sua sensibilidade a motion clarity. Esses presets são um comparativo controlado, não uma promessa de que a tela está exibindo cada frame perfeitamente.
Como obter resultados mais confiáveis no navegador
Mantenha o teste em primeiro plano, desative o modo de economia de bateria e feche abas pesadas ou apps que usem GPU. Em monitor externo, confirme no sistema a taxa de atualização esperada e evite espelhamento enquanto mede. Deixe a página rodar por pelo menos dez segundos antes de tirar conclusões. Depois, use o refresh-rate-test para mais contexto de Hz e o ghosting-test se blur ou trailing parecerem piores do que o número de FPS indica.
FAQ
O que este frame rate test mede de verdade?
Ele mede o timing de renderização do navegador com requestAnimationFrame e mostra quantos frames esta página está produzindo agora.
FPS é a mesma coisa que taxa de atualização?
Não. FPS é o número de frames renderizados por segundo; taxa de atualização é quantas vezes a tela pode atualizar a imagem por segundo.
Por que meu FPS é menor do que a taxa do monitor?
Porque navegador, sistema, energia, adaptadores e carga em segundo plano podem limitar a renderização abaixo do potencial da tela.
Por que o gráfico oscila mesmo quando o número parece estável?
O número principal é suavizado. O gráfico revela pequenas variações, drops e jitter de pacing que um valor arredondado esconde.
A página consegue detectar 120 Hz, 144 Hz ou 240 Hz?
Ela consegue estimar a cadência observada no navegador e aproximar tiers comuns, mas não deve ser tratada como certificação de hardware.
Por que o resultado muda entre navegadores?
Cada navegador lida de forma diferente com animação, economia de energia, extensões e composição gráfica.
Modo de economia de energia afeta o teste?
Sim. Ele pode reduzir a taxa de animação ou forçar um cap mais baixo.
Por que o teste muda quando a aba perde foco?
Porque abas em background costumam ser limitadas pelo navegador para economizar recursos.
Isso é igual ao FPS de um jogo?
Não. Jogos usam engine, carga e pipeline próprios. Aqui você mede performance de movimento no navegador.
Como melhorar a suavidade de movimento?
Confira a taxa de atualização no sistema, desligue economia de bateria, mantenha a aba em primeiro plano e compare depois com refresh-rate-test e ghosting-test.
Ferramentas relacionadas
Refresh Rate Test
Compare o FPS do navegador com um refresh rate test dedicado para entender melhor a cadência estimada da tela.